How do you approximate in Matlab?

How do you approximate in Matlab?

Y round( X , N ) rounds to N digits: N x26gt; 0 : round to N digits to the right of the decimal point. N 0 : round to the nearest integer.

What does ~= mean in Matlab?

not equal

What is Tol in Matlab?

Accepted Answer The tol input argument lets you specify what constitutes close enough.

How do you get decimal answers in Matlab?

Direct link to this answer

  • If you want to display decimal ( floating point) numbers try : Theme. x26gt;x26gt;format long % or format short.
  • If you want fractional display try : Theme. x26gt;x26gt;format rat.
  • and try : Theme. x26gt;x26gt;doc format.

How do you approximate numbers in MATLAB?

Y round( X , N ) rounds to N digits:

  • N x26gt; 0 : round to N digits to the right of the decimal point.
  • N 0 : round to the nearest integer.
  • N x26lt; 0 : round to N digits to the left of the decimal point.

What is approximation MATLAB?

Approximations During Model Analysis To create reasonable limits on the analysis, the software performs approximations to simplify the analysis. The software records any approximations it performed in the Analysis Information chapter of the Simulink Design Verifier HTML report.

How do you approximate pi in MATLAB?

pi as a sum

  • . Leibniz discovered that u03c0 can be approximated using the formula.
  • u03c0 4 * u2211((-1)^k)/(2k+1)
  • (a) Write a MATLAB function pi_approx1(n) that returns the approximation of u03c0 using the first n terms of the Leibniz series above.

23-Jan-2018

What is ~= in MATLAB?

A ~ B returns a logical array with elements set to logical 1 ( true ) where arrays A and B are not equal; otherwise, the element is logical 0 ( false ). The test compares both real and imaginary parts of numeric arrays. ne returns logical 1 ( true ) where A or B have NaN or undefined categorical elements.

What is %s in MATLAB?

%s represents character vector(containing letters) and %f represents fixed point notation(containining numbers). In your case you want to print letters so if you use %f formatspec you won’t get the desired result.

What does a (: 1 mean in MATLAB?

Direct link to this answer A(:,:,1) means: all rows and all columns of A that are in its first page. (The third dimension is referred to in the MATLAB documentation as a page, just as the first dimension is row and the second is column).

What does apostrophe mean in MATLAB?

complex conjugate transpose

What does Y (: 1 mean MATLAB?

If you define a bidimensional array y, and you want to access all its elements on the first column: y(:,1) will do it. If you want to access to all the elements of the fift row: y(5,:) is the syntax you have to use. The colon means: take all the elements along the specified dimension.

What is Tol math?

The Tolerance parameter. Look at how the system variable Convergence Tolerance (TOL) affects the results of definite integrals. You can set TOL on the Calculation tab, in the Worksheet Settings group, or directly in the worksheet.

What is step tolerance?

You can also find the default tolerances in the options section of the solver function reference page. StepTolerance is a lower bound on the size of a step, meaning the norm of (xi xi+1). If the solver attempts to take a step that is smaller than StepTolerance , the iterations end.

What is <= in Matlab?

A x26lt; B returns a logical array with elements set to logical 1 ( true ) where A is less than or equal to B ; otherwise, the element is logical 0 ( false ). The test compares only the real part of numeric arrays.

How do you do less than equal to in Matlab?

xae.Array Comparison with Relational Operators.SymbolFunction EquivalentDescriptionx26lt;ltLess thanx26lt;leLess than or equal tox26gt;gtGreater thanx26gt;geGreater than or equal to2 more rows

How do I get only 2 decimal places in MATLAB?

For display purposes, use sprintf to control the exact display of a number as a string. For example, to display exactly 2 decimal digits of pi (and no trailing zeros), use sprintf(%.2f,pi) .

How do I show 6 decimal places in MATLAB?

If you want to round a number to the sixth decimal place you could do round(x*10^6)/10^6 . b3

How do you convert a fraction to a decimal in MATLAB?

fraction to decimal conversion

  • I [ 1 0 0.
  • 0 1 0.
  • 0 0 1 ];
  • A [ -0.0386 0.0386 0.
  • 0.0386 -0.0771 0.0386.
  • 0 0.0386 -0.0606 ]
  • syms s.
  • T1;

How do you use %d in MATLAB?

Conversion Character.SpecifierDescriptiondDecimal notation (signed).eExponential notation (using a lowercase e , as in 3.1415e+00 ).10 more rows

How do you do decimal approximation in MATLAB?

Direct link to this answer

  • If you want to display decimal ( floating point) numbers try : Theme. x26gt;x26gt;format long % or format short.
  • If you want fractional display try : Theme. x26gt;x26gt;format rat.
  • and try : Theme. x26gt;x26gt;doc format.

How do you set a number to precision in MATLAB?

You can set a higher precision by using the digits function. Approximate a sum using the default precision of 32 digits. If at least one input is wrapped with vpa , all other inputs are converted to variable precision automatically. You must wrap all inner inputs with vpa , such as exp(vpa(200)) .

How do I show 3 decimal places in MATLAB?

Rounding to decimal places

  • look at the first digit after the decimal point if rounding to one decimal place or the second digit for two decimal places.
  • draw a vertical line to the right of the place value digit that is required.
  • look at the next digit.
  • if the next digit is 5 or more, increase the previous digit by one.

What is Matlab rat?

Y round( X , N ) rounds to N digits: N x26gt; 0 : round to N digits to the right of the decimal point. N 0 : round to the nearest integer.

How do I show fractions in Matlab?

R rat( X ) returns the rational fraction approximation of X to within the default tolerance, 1e-6*norm(X(:),1) . The approximation is a character array containing the truncated continued fractional expansion. example.

Leave a Comment